在WSL2上配置Golang环境的完整指南

在WSL2上配置Golang环境的完整指南 如何在 Windows 电脑的 WSL2 上安装 Golang

2 回复

在你的WSL上安装一个Linux发行版(例如Ubuntu,可在商店中找到),并按照Linux系统的步骤操作。

https://golang.org/doc/install

不过,如果你不习惯在服务器模式下工作,你可以在主机上安装Go生态系统,并将二进制文件部署到Linux环境中。

更多关于在WSL2上配置Golang环境的完整指南的实战系列教程也可以访问 https://www.itying.com/category-94-b0.html


在WSL2上配置Golang环境可以通过以下步骤完成:

  1. 更新系统包列表
sudo apt update
  1. 安装Golang(以最新稳定版1.21为例):
wget https://go.dev/dl/go1.21.0.linux-amd64.tar.gz
sudo tar -C /usr/local -xzf go1.21.0.linux-amd64.tar.gz
rm go1.21.0.linux-amd64.tar.gz
  1. 配置环境变量
echo 'export PATH=$PATH:/usr/local/go/bin' >> ~/.bashrc
echo 'export GOPATH=$HOME/go' >> ~/.bashrc
echo 'export PATH=$PATH:$GOPATH/bin' >> ~/.bashrc
source ~/.bashrc
  1. 验证安装
go version
  1. 创建测试项目验证环境
mkdir -p ~/test-project
cd ~/test-project
go mod init test-project

创建main.go文件:

package main

import "fmt"

func main() {
    fmt.Println("Golang环境配置成功!")
}

运行测试:

go run main.go
  1. 配置代理加速(可选):
go env -w GOPROXY=https://goproxy.cn,direct

安装完成后,可以通过go env查看完整的Golang环境配置。

回到顶部